| Property | Value | Source |
|---|---|---|
| Molecular Mass | 99.09 g/mol | CAS Common Chemistry |
| 99.08900000000001 g/mol | RDKit | |
| 99.089 g/mol | RDKit | |
| Density | 1.13 g/cm³ | CAS Common Chemistry |
| 1.1288 g/cm3 @ 20 °C | CAS Common Chemistry | |
| Boiling Point | 200.5 °C | CAS Common Chemistry |
| Canonical SMILES | N#CCC(=O)OC | CAS Common Chemistry |
| InChI | InChI=1S/C4H5NO2/c1-7-4(6)2-3-5/h2H2,1H3 | CAS Common Chemistry |
| InChI Key | InChIKey=ANGDWNBGPBMQHW-UHFFFAOYSA-N | CAS Common Chemistry |
| Melting Point | -22.5 °C | CAS Common Chemistry |
| Name | Methyl cyanoacetate | CAS Common Chemistry |
